The bill
To am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 to provide for in-service rollovers for individual retirement annuity purchases.
HR. 6324, 119th Congress β read as touching Insurance (P&C and Life).

Which industries are materially affected by specific provisions in this bill. 2 helped.
Section 2(a) permits rollovers to individual retirement annuities (as defined in section 408(b)), directly benefiting insurance companies that issue such annuity contracts.
